基于MTHFR基因多态性分析不同时期叶酸摄入与子痫前期及其亚型的相关性

摘    要:目的基于亚甲基四氢叶酸还原酶(MTHFR)基因多态性分析不同时期叶酸(FA)摄入与子痫前期及亚型的相关性。方法选取2017年6月-2018年12月在该院进行治疗的180例子痫前期孕妇为研究组,根据不同子痫前期亚型将研究组分为轻度子痫前期组98例和重度子痫前期组82例;另选取同期该院收治的50例健康孕妇为对照组。比较各组孕妇血清中同型半胱氨酸(Hcy)、FA及维生素B12(VitB12)含量,测定各组孕妇外周血中MTHFR基因多态性,比较不同基因型中Hcy、FA及VitB12水平,并将各指标间及指标水平与病情程度进行相关性分析,同时观察各组孕妇妊娠结局。结果子痫前期孕妇血清中Hcy水平明显高于对照组,FA水平明显低于对照组,差异均有统计学意义(均P<0.05)。轻度子痫前期孕妇血清中VitB12水平明显低于对照组及重度子痫前期组,差异均有统计学意义(均P<0.05)。子痫前期孕妇MTHFR基因C677T位点中CC及CT基因型比例明显低于对照组,子痫前期孕妇MTHFR基因C677T位点中TT基因型比例明显高于对照组;子痫前期孕妇T等位基因频率明显高于对照组,C等位基因频率明显低于对照组;TT及CT基因型孕妇血清中Hcy水平明显高于CC基因型孕妇,TT及CT基因型孕妇血清中FA及VitB12水平明显低于CC基因型孕妇,差异均有统计学意义(均P<0.05)。子痫前期孕妇血清中Hcy水平与FA呈负相关关系(P<0.05);子痫前期孕妇血清中FA水平与VitB12呈正相关关系(P<0.05);血清中Hcy水与子痫前期孕妇病情程度呈正相关关系(P<0.05);血清中FA水平与子痫前期孕妇病情程度呈负相关关系(P<0.05)。重度子痫前期孕妇胎盘早剥、剖宫产、早产、低体质量儿、胎儿窘迫、新生儿窒息及死胎的发生率明显高于轻度子痫前期组及对照组,差异均有统计学意义(均P<0.05)。结论MTHFR基因C677T位点可通过影响体内Hcy、FA及VitB12水平参与子痫前期过程,同时FA的缺乏可导致体内Hcy水平升高,可能是导致子痫前期发生重要原因,MTHFR基因多态性可作为预测子痫前期孕妇妊娠结局的风险指标。

Correlation between folic acid intake and preeclampsia and its subtypes in different periods based on MTHFR gene polymorphism

Abstract:Objective To discuss the correlation between folic acid(FA)intakeand preeclampsia and its subtypes in different periods based on MTHFR gene polymorphism.Methods Selected 180 cases of preeclampsia pregnant women who were treated in the hospital from June 2017 to December 2018 as the study group.The study group was divided into mild preeclampsia group(98 cases)and severe preeclampsia group(82 cases)according to different preeclampsia subtypes.In addition,50 healthy pregnant women who were treated in the hospital in the same period were selected as the control group.The levels of homocysteine(Hcy),FA and vitamin B12(VitB12)in the serum of pregnant women in each group were compared.And the MTHFR gene polymorphism in peripheral blood of pregnant women in each group were measured.Further,the Hcy,FA and VitB12 levels in different genotypes were compared and the correlation between indexes or each index and the degree of pathogenetic condition was analyzed.Meanwhile,the pregnancy outcome of pregnant women in each group was observed.Results In preeclampsia pregnant women,serum Hcy level was significantly higher than that of the control group,and the FA level was markedly lower than that of the control group,all with statistically significant differences(all P<0.05).Serum VitB12 level in mild preeclampsia group was distinctly lower than that of the control group and severe preeclampsia group,the differences of which were statistically significant(all P<0.05).In mild preeclampsia group,the proportions of CC and CT genotypes in C677T locus of MTHFR gene were obviously lower than that in the control group but the proportion of TT genotype was markedly higher than that of the control group;the frequency of T allele was significantly higher than that of the control group;the frequency of C allele was dramatically lower than that of the control group.Serum Hcy expression of TT genotype and CT genotype pregnant women was remarkably higher than that of CC genotype pregnant women,however,serum FA and VitB12 expression of TT genotype and CT genotype pregnant women was remarkably lower than that of CC genotype pregnant women,all with statistically significant differences(all P<0.05).Among preeclampsia pregnant women,serum Hcy expression was negatively related with FA expression(P<0.05);serum FA expression was positively related with VitB12 expression(P<0.05);serum Hcy expression was in positive association(P<0.05)and FA expression was in negative association with the degree of pathogenetic condition(P<0.05).The incidence rates of placental abruption,cesarean section,premature delivery,low-birth-weight infants,fetal distress,neonatal asphyxia and stillbirth in severe preeclampsia group was significantly higher than those in mild preeclampsia group and control group,with all differences statistically significant(all P<0.05).Conclusion The C677T locus of MTHFR gene could participate in the process of preeclampsia by influencing Hcy,FA and VitB12 levels.The lack of FA resulted in the elevation of Hcy expression,which might be the main reason for the occurrence of preeclampsia.MTHFR gene polymorphism can be used as a predictor for the pregnancy outcomes of preeclampsia pregnant women.
